Black PES Copolyester Hot Melt Web Adhesive For Automotive Interior

Advanced Bonding Solution for Automotive Interiors

Black PES Copolyester Hot Melt Web Adhesive is a kind of hot melt adhesive based on polyester (PES) copolyester material—typically appearing as non-woven state. It is not tacky when unheated, but melts and flows upon heating to a specific temperature, then solidifies upon cooling, forming a strong adhesive layer between substrates.

This hot melt adhesive web is widely used in automotive interior manufacturing, particularly in thermal bonding processes, and is one of the key materials in thermal bonding solutions.

Product Specifications
Type Material Melting Range (℃) Recommended Press Temperature (℃) Typical Application
JCC-W125 Copolyester 107-140 130-140 Clothes, Shoes, Car interior
JCC-W125FR Copolyester 110-145 135-145 Car Interior
JCC-W135FR Copolyester 112-145 135-145 Car Interior, Car Exterior
JCC-W165 Copolyester 135-160 150-160 Car Interior

Typical Automotive Interior Applications

PES hot melt web thermal bonding solutions are commonly used for:

  • Headliner lamination (fabric to foam / substrate)
  • Door panel soft trim bonding
  • Instrument panel fabric lamination
  • Seat upholstery bonding (fabric to foam)
  • Interior decorative parts and trims
